Well, they told me that Windows 10 would be the last version of that OS and they’d just iterate on it. I took them at their word.
Turned out they were right. At least for me.
I turned off my last Windows 10 machine before Christmas, I don’t have a Windows 11 machine, and my new Linux Framework laptop is great.
25+ years ago I was using Slackware as a primary desktop for about 10 years.
Today, I’m back on Linux as a primary desktop but the difference is – there’s no longer any Windows machines in my house.
1000+ Steam titles, all my software (always used a lot of freeware/OS anyway, and even my Windows freeware runs just fine), updates that take seconds and happen in the background, and things just work. Nothing’s pressured me to change my browser, install AI, reboot for 45 minutes of updates (ironically, I turned on my Win10 machine briefly after 2 days of it being off to move the last of my files off it, and it LITERALLY spun for 45 minutes installing updates and I had no choice in the matter), interfere in my searches for „Chrome“, popped up a dozen product advertisement notifications, stole my file associations, insist I must have a TPM chip etc.
Windows 10 truly was the last version of Windows.
